Looking at various places on my wife's reservation her name is showing up "strangely".

 

It's either Firstname CPA Lastname or Firstname CPA or Firstname Lastname CPA.  I did book the flt using my points so I don't know if that matters.  She has another flt. booked using my points and it doesn't show up with the "CPA". in her name

The reservation booked with her points is using the name information stored in her Rapid Rewards account.  CPA is a optional suffix that can be added to a stored name.  If that is incorrectly included you can contact Southwest to have it removed.  The reservations for her that were "purchased" with someone else's points did not use stored information and the name was typed in.  That explains the differences.  CPA included or not will not affect the reservation or interaction with TSA.
